Example center supervisor requirements on a job description

Center supervisor requirements can be divided into technical requirements and required soft skills. The lists below show the most common requirements included in center supervisor job postings.
Sample center supervisor requirements
  • At least 2 years of experience in a supervisory role
  • Bachelor's degree in business administration or related field
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
Sample required center supervisor soft skills
  • Strong leadership and decision-making abilities
  • Ability to multitask and prioritize tasks effectively
  • Positive attitude and ability to motivate team members
  • Strong problem-solving and critical-thinking skills
  • Ability to work well under pressure and meet deadlines

Center supervisor job description example 1

Equifax center supervisor job description

Employee Service Support Supervisor manages the leads and employees who assist external consumers and internal clients with complex questions/problems regarding multiple Employee Service products and services. S/he educates consumers about the teams, partners with other departments to ensure escalated issues are addressed and processes are followed and reports on the teams' performances.
What you'll do :
Manages activities of leads and employees to insure the teams are functioning effectively to meet consumer/clients' needs and operational initiative targets. Develop/communicates processes and policies. Creates tactical short and long-term goals that support the team's vision and strategy. Responds promptly to escalations. (Approx. 60%) Contributes to team's process improvement efforts and implements changes in a positive way. Incorporates client feedback into efforts. (Approx. 10%) Develops partnerships with other internal groups and business units to improve speed of issues resolutions and to recommend product improvements. (Approx. 10%) Produces and analyzes statistical reports to monitor teams' performance; also monitors service-related trends to share with Business Units, Product Management, Vertical leads. (Approx. 10%) Participates in projects, including budget process, as assigned. Serves as an ambassador for the team in internal/external meetings, site visits, etc. (Approx. 10%)

What experience you need :
High school diploma, or GED.Experience leading a team, preferable in a call center or customer service environment.Experience managing to expected behaviors and outcomes (versus "just the numbers").Working knowledge of MS Office components: Outlook, Word, Excel, and PowerPoint.Ability to learn Siemens OpenScape Contact Center and Equifax applications. Working knowledge of CRM tools.Familiarity with ticketing software.

What could set you apart:
Bachelor's degree Working knowledge of Equifax applications and services.1-3 years of experience.

VIP Petcare is the premier provider of pet wellness and non-emergency veterinary services. We deliver affordable, and convenient veterinary services in a friendly, positive environment.

Our Wellness Centers provide high quality preventive and wellness pet care services, including diagnostic tests, vaccinations, preventative medications, microchipping, nail trims, and more!

VIP Petcare Center Supervisors are the leaders in their center. With guidance from their District Manager, they use their skills as a coach and manager to perform a wide range of clinical, administrative, and training activities.

Above all, Center Supervisors are responsible for making sure their teams are delivering an exceptional client experience every day!

· Making recommendations for services and products aligned with our Standards of Care
· Leading, coaching, hiring, and developing staff at all levels
· Communicating with and building relationships with the Host Retailer Management Team
· Preparing vaccines
· Restraining pets for wellness procedures and sample collection
· Preparing samples for outside laboratory testing
· Assisting the doctor with the creation and maintenance of comprehensive records
· Leading a culture of safety in your center
· Collecting payment and reviewing discharge paperwork with clients
· Keeping the examination areas clean and ready for patients
· Strategically scheduling team members in the center
· Facilitating the inventory process and leveraging an expense budget
· Managing end of day reconciliation
Being responsible for growing the client base and profitability of the center
